House prices rocketing in Helsinki Metropolitan Area


House prices rocketing in Helsinki Metropolitan Area
 print this
The high demand for single-family houses has continued to increase their prices in the entire Helsinki Metropolitan Area. According to the Finnish Real Estate Agents’ Association, prices of detached and semi-detached houses rose by around 9-13 % in the area in the course of the last twelve months.
      The demand for reasonably-priced building lots is also growing rapidly. According to the recent information issued by the Helsinki Metropolitan Area Council, the increase in the prices of building lots in Espoo was 20% in the period from January - August, and 17% in Vantaa.
     
While well educated people previously moved from Helsinki to Espoo, they now head for Vantaa, where the prices are the most reasonable in the entire region.
     
On the other hand, people with an average income used to move from Helsinki to Vantaa. However, migration has influenced the price of housing, especially in the outer ring of neighbouring municipalities, and today those who wish to buy less expensive houses have to move further north to Nurmijärvi, Tuusula, or Kerava.
      Even in Eastern and North-eastern Helsinki, the prices of one-family houses have grown sharply, whereas the prices of flats are the least expensive in the area. According to researchers, this implies that the City of Helsinki is focusing too much on the production of apartment buildings, and consequently only people with high income can afford to live in private houses.
